Output e744391b43781de69cdfa93b1e367abc98c038da478debfeb990a3516973ae66:0

value
2615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ad56d343f2421692f29bb73dcaeb08f943c2a5d8 OP_EQUAL
address
3HVYqTLeDJEW4JjkCJi8ehJxkb3qPjJP43
transaction
e744391b43781de69cdfa93b1e367abc98c038da478debfeb990a3516973ae66